About Boquerón

Boquerón is a small town in Peru (Ucayali) with a population of 1,742. The city sits at an elevation of 1,991 feet (607 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 65°F (18°C). Temperatures range from 70°F in January to 64°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 133.5 inches. The timezone is America/Lima.

Earthquake History

315 earthquakes (M2.5+) within 150 km since 1990. Strongest: M6.0. Most recent: M4.4 on Jul 27, 2025.
